Commerzbank AG stock (DE000CBK1001): Recent quarterly results and market position

11.05.2026 - 13:47:54 | ad-hoc-news.de

Commerzbank AG released Q1 2026 results showing revenue growth amid German banking sector challenges. The stock has seen volatility, trading around recent levels on Xetra.

Commerzbank AG, a leading German bank, reported its first quarter 2026 earnings on May 8, 2026, with total income rising 5% year-over-year to €3.2 billion for the period ended March 31, 2026, according to Commerzbank IR as of 05/08/2026. Net profit increased to €782 million, beating prior-year figures, driven by higher net interest income. This performance underscores resilience in a high-interest-rate environment affecting European lenders.

The stock traded at €14.85 on Xetra on May 10, 2026, up 1.2% from the previous close, according to Börse Frankfurt as of 05/10/2026. Shares have gained 8% year-to-date, reflecting investor confidence in the bank's cost discipline and digital transformation efforts. For US investors, Commerzbank offers exposure to Europe's largest economy via its Frankfurt listing.

Commerzbank AG: core business model

Commerzbank AG operates as a universal bank serving private, small business, corporate, and institutional clients primarily in Germany and key European markets. Its three main segments—Private and Small Business Customers, Corporate Clients, and Asset Management—generated €12.5 billion in total income for 2025 as reported in the annual results published March 2026, according to Commerzbank IR as of 03/2026. The bank emphasizes digital services through its kombo app, which has over 10 million users.

Founded in 1870, Commerzbank holds a strong position in the DAX index and focuses on sustainable profitability targets, aiming for a 10% return on tangible equity by 2028 as outlined in its 2023 strategy update. It manages €500 billion in assets under management, providing diversified revenue streams resilient to economic cycles.

Main revenue and product drivers for Commerzbank AG

Net interest income remains the largest driver, contributing 55% of Q1 2026 total income at €1.8 billion, up 12% from Q1 2025 due to elevated ECB rates, per the earnings release on May 8, 2026. Commission income from payments and advisory services added €1.1 billion, while trading income provided diversification. Corporate banking, including trade finance, supports Mittelstand firms key to Germany's export economy.

Digital transformation has boosted efficiency, with cost-income ratio improving to 64% in Q1 2026 from 70% a year earlier. Key products include savings accounts, mortgages, and ESG-focused investment funds, appealing to retail clients amid rising sustainability demands in Europe.

Industry trends and competitive position

The European banking sector faces margin pressures from potential rate cuts, but Commerzbank benefits from its domestic focus, holding 15% market share in German retail deposits. Competitors like Deutsche Bank emphasize global investment banking, while Commerzbank prioritizes cost control and client proximity. Sector-wide digital adoption, per a S&P Global report dated April 2026, positions Commerzbank favorably with its modernized IT infrastructure.

Why Commerzbank AG matters for US investors

US investors gain indirect exposure to Germany's industrial powerhouse through Commerzbank's lending to exporters like automotive and machinery firms reliant on US trade. Listed on US platforms via OTC (CRZBY), it offers a play on Eurozone recovery without direct currency risk for diversified portfolios. Its DAX inclusion ensures liquidity for international trading.

Conclusion

Commerzbank AG's solid Q1 2026 results highlight operational strength amid macroeconomic shifts, with revenue growth and profit beats supporting its strategic goals. While European rate dynamics pose challenges, the bank's focus on core markets and digital efficiency provides stability. Investors track upcoming ECB decisions and Q2 earnings for further direction, maintaining a balanced view on its trajectory.
